While white is the classic choice for Shaker cabinets, embracing colours like navy blue, grey, or even black can add a contemporary twist. Pairing darker cabinet colours with lighter countertops and backsplashes creates a beautiful contrast that enhances the modern feel of the space.

How to make white shaker cabinets look modern?

Combine Shaker Cabinets With Other Styles

Shaker cabinet doors can also be combined with other styles to create a unique look. For example, you could pair shaker cabinets with glass doors to create a modern look. Or you could combine shaker cabinets with raised panel doors to create a traditional look.

How to make a shaker kitchen look modern?

Use bold colours

Traditional Shaker kitchens feature decorated furniture in shades of blue, green, red and yellow, while neutral shades like grey and cream are also popular. Bold colours will instantly modernise a Shaker kitchen and draw attention to the cabinetry, as seen in our green Shaker kitchen.

How can I make my shaker cabinets look better?

Use a good primer and use a brush for the ``inside'' of the cabinet first to get the inside edges. Then use a small roller to do the rest. Once that is dry on all the cabinets, go back with an enamel paint. Make sure to use a ventilated place or open windows! That is strong stuff!

What are the disadvantages of shaker cabinets?

Cons of Shaker Kitchen Cabinets

Here are a few things that might make you think twice about investing in them: Simple Design: Shaker kitchen cabinets can be a bit “plain vanilla” – classic but maybe too simple. If you want fancy, shaker cabinets are not for you. They don't have intricate designs, patterns, or styles.

Can shaker cabinets be transitional?

On the other hand, Shaker cabinets work as transitional kitchen cabinets too because they look right at home (pardon the pun) in a contemporary kitchen, when the colors, hardware and other details are contemporary.

What is the best color for a shaker kitchen?

Alongside classic White, explore cool tones such as Porcelain and Dove Grey for a fresh, contemporary look. Alternatively, Stone, Mussel and Taupe Grey for a warmer, more cosy feel. Embracing Natural tones can provide a feeling of comfort and cosiness, whilst also having a timeless style.

Are shaker cabinets outdated?

They've been producing furniture in the US since the 1700's, so I'd say no, it's unlikely that shaker style cabinets will go out of style anytime soon. The materials and finishes on them have and will continue to do so, but a basic shaker style door is pretty timeless.

Are honey maple cabinets outdated?

Maple wood kitchen cabinets are incredibly versatile! And far from outdated. They're one of the most durable woods used in kitchen cabinets, and with the right finishes, they can fit in perfectly with any look, whether it's a traditional, modern, rustic, or contemporary kitchen.

How to update old white kitchen cabinets?

Bring an on-trend look to the space by painting the lower cabinets one color and the upper cabinets another color. This is a great way to upgrade an all-white kitchen, fast. Paint the lower cabinets and leave the top ones white.
